Many solvent dyes are used as components by the biological stain manufacturing community to produce stains. Oil soluble solvent dyes have better temperature stability in engineering plastics, very high brightness and do result in completely transparent plastics without any haze and light scattering. Processing is easy and process parameters like viscosity remain unaffected.
Besides plastics industry, a major application for solvent dyes is printing or solvent based writing ink. Furthermore, oil soluble dyes are widely used in rubbers, oil inks, spinning, waxes, smoke, paints, color paste, transfer printing, marking pens, ball point pens, candles, oil, fats, solvents, bitumen, lubricants, marking inks, inkjet printing inks, dye sublimation printing, glass coloration, signaling smoke, firework and in the pyrotechnics industries, gold imitation, other transparent metallic effects of metallized polyester films, other hydrocarbon-based non-polar materials.

Solvent Orange 60 is used in coloring for polystyrene, PS, HIPS, ABS, PC, RPVC, PMMA, SAN, AS, PET, resin, polymethyl methacrylate, unplasticized pvc and other plastics, also used in coloring of estron, caprone and terylene etc.
